Text

(a)The staff judge advocates in each component of the state's military forces or such judge advocate's designee shall make frequent inspections in the field under the supervision of the administration of military justice in that force.
(b)Commanding officers shall at all times communicate directly with their staff judge advocates in matters relating to the administration of military justice. The judge advocate of any command is entitled to communicate directly with the staff judge advocate of a superior or subordinate command or with the state judge advocate.
